Navarre experiences all four seasons with humid summers and cold winters, which can cause wood floors to expand and contract. For this reason, engineered hardwood or luxury vinyl plank (LVP) are often more stable choices than solid hardwood. For basements or ground-level rooms, moisture-resistant options like tile or specific LVP are recommended due to potential humidity and groundwater.
Costs vary widely by material, but for a standard room (e.g., 300 sq. ft.), professional installation in our region typically ranges from $1,200 to $4,500. Basic carpet or sheet vinyl may be on the lower end, while materials like hardwood or intricate tile work are higher. Always get a detailed, in-home estimate from a local installer, as subfloor conditions in older Navarre homes can impact the final price.
Late summer and early fall are often ideal, as humidity levels start to drop, which is beneficial for adhesive curing and wood acclimation. Winter installations are possible but require careful scheduling around potential snowstorms, and you must ensure delivered materials acclimate inside your home for 48-72 hours before installation to adjust to your heated indoor climate.
Prioritize licensed and insured local contractors with verifiable references in Stark or Tuscarawas County. Check for membership in organizations like the NWFA (for wood) or the CTEF (for tile). A reputable Navarre-area installer will always conduct an on-site inspection to assess your subfloor and discuss how local factors, like a high water table in some areas, might affect the installation.
For a straightforward flooring replacement, a permit is generally not required in Navarre or most Ohio municipalities. However, if the project involves structural changes to the subfloor, altering egress in a basement, or is part of a larger remodel that requires electrical/plumbing work, a permit may be necessary. Always confirm with the Navarre Village Building Department or your contractor should handle this.
